Ticket #917 — Vault locked, blocking pagination work

New contractor onboarding issue. The Brackwater API credentials vault auto-sealed overnight, so you can't pull the staging keys needed to test cursor pagination on the public Tidewell REST endpoints. Context: we're moving /v2 listings from offset to cursor-based paging; specs are in the Mallow wiki. Fix is simple — unseal via the Roake admin console, then regenerate your staging token. The console will prompt once; the recovery passphrase it expects is directly below.

vault phrase of tajeg-tageg = pelix-druix-holius-briael-zorwyn-frawyn-fraox-norok-drueth-aldiel

Test Plan Note — Calendar Sync Conflict (Tindervale Scheduler)

Scenario: two clients edit the same event offline, then sync. Expected behavior: the Larkmoor merge service keeps the later timestamp and files a conflict record. Verify the losing edit appears in the conflicts pane and no duplicate events are created. Run against the staging tenant only. Authenticate your test client to the sync endpoint using the bearer token below.

bearer token for hagug-kawip: eyJhbGciOiJIUzI1NiIsInR5cCI6IkpXVCJ9.eyJzdWIiOiIydxNAjDeTmIn0.L86yxoGFcrhy

Subject: Permit blueprints for Halbren Civic Annex

Hi dispatch — the stamped blueprint set for the Halbren Civic Annex building permit is ready at the Morvale print room. The driver should collect the tube today and bring it to the county intake window before it closes. Please pass the following hand-over instruction to the driver.

handover note for yagef-bagep: the drudor pelius courier leaves the kasdor zorvan norir ledger at gate 8016 under passcode 755406

Action item: map-tile prefetcher cache bound (Wayfern incident)

Owner: platform team. The Wayfern prefetcher filled disk on three edge nodes, degrading map loads for two hours. Fix: enforce a hard cache ceiling and evict by region age. Support should flag any repeat reports of blank tiles as possible recurrence. Status updates and the rollout schedule are tracked on the page below.

wiki page, bageg-kahif: https://gitlab.qorvellabs.internal/view/spaces/job/2a5e7e5f1a93